A new Michigan Medicine study led by Dr. James Dupree evaluates the accuracy of a national commercial claims database for tracking IVF outcomes, offering a potential tool for shaping reproductive health policy. The research could help inform decisions by lawmakers exploring insurance mandates and by employers considering expanded fertility benefits.
